P-40B/Hawk 81 Super Detailed Cockpit Set with Seatbelts

kit number CEC32145

Reviewed By James Kelley, #42103

MSRP: $25.99 USD

When Trumpeter introduced the Curtiss P-40B/Hawk 81 Kit, large-scale aficionados had a 1/32 scale, overall accurate tiger to add to their collection. One of the major gripes critics had regarding this kit was the cockpit. Like the F4U-1D kit, complete with floor (which Corsairs didn’t have!), this kit was too much of a good thing. The inaccurate flooring came up so high, the scale pilots wouldn’t be able to see over their knees! All kidding aside, the side panels were much too short, and the flooring wasn’t accurate. The actual aircraft’s cockpit floor was the ventral aspect of the main wing section, and was hence curved. There were a few other relatively minor shortcomings to this kit, but the obvious deformities of its primary focal point was the most distressing to modelers.

Enter Meteor Production’s resin works, “Cutting Edge Model Works”. In the typical tradition of this company, they produced one of their “Super Detailed” cockpit sets. Molded in the by-now-familiar tough, but very easy to work with gray resin, this cockpit set will add accurate detail to your large-scale P-40 in a big way. The set is comprised of 13 gray pieces, an acetate instrument dial panel, and a resin seat harness (cast in Cutting Edge’s “poseable” resin formula).

The poseable belts and harnesses cast in this manner are outstanding; they alone add a touch of detail and realism to any kit, and are the perfect finishing touch to an outstanding set like this! The detail on this set must be seen to be appreciated;  for example, the forward end of the plane’s fuel tank is molded into the headrest/bulkhead, which is a nice touch. The various throttle and control handles are nicely represented here, and the side panels, which are the correct height (or should I say depth?) mesh accordingly with the wing/floor. The pilot’s seat is accurately shaped, and will be a welcome relief for the kit’s misshapen one.

Also included is a comprehensive, step-by-step instruction sheet with clear photos of where things should go, and a few helpful suggestions.

Cutting Edge products have a reputation for highly accurate, nicely-fitting resin detail sets, and this one lives up the company’s name…and more importantly, to modeler’s high expectations! Very Much recommended to anyone who plans to invest in the Trumpeter P-40B kit.
